Diascia Diamonte Coral Rose F1

2006 AAS Cool Season Bedding Plant Winner

Diamonte Coral Rose is an improved variety in a class that was relatively unknown five years ago. Diascia is native to South Africa, like gerbera and dimorphotheca. Diamonte Coral Rose exhibits earliness, freedom of bloom and hybrid vigor as improved traits. There is a connection among all three because as a breeder creates a hybrid, these multiple qualities are the breeding objectives. Hybrid vigor results in a long blooming season and profuse flowering which judges observed during the trial. Diamonte Coral Rose is a frost-tolerant annual. The plants perform well during the hot summer growing season and under cool growing conditions, such as the fall and winter seasons in southern locations. The category, Cool Season Bedding Plant Trial, means Diamonte Coral Rose was tested at southern sites during the winter and won the award.

Diamonte Coral Rose flowers are tubular with backward pointing spurs. The five-lobed blooms have broad lower lobes. Diamonte Coral Rose plants have a spreading habit and are perfectly designed for any container. Planting them close to the lip will encourage the plant to cascade over the side. Needing a full sun growing location, Diamonte Coral Rose combines well with other cool tolerant annuals, such as snapdragons or dianthus. Exceptional garden performance can be expected from Diamonte Coral Rose.

AAS WINNER DETAILS

Winner Type: National
Class: Diascia
Variety Name: Diamonte Coral Rose F1
Genus: Diascia
Species: intergerimma
Year: 2006
Common Name: Diascia
Type: Flowers from Seed
Breeder: PanAmerican Seed
Close Market Comparison: Pink Queen and Rose Queen

PLANT NEEDS

Duration Type: Annual
Light Needs: Full sun
Water Needs: Normal
Dead Heading Recommended: No
Staking Required: No

PLANT CHARACTERISTICS

Foliage Color: Green
Plant Habit: Spreading, upright
Plant Height: 8-10 inches
Bloom Time: Late spring, summer, fall
Bloom Color: Coral
Bloom Color Pattern: Solid
Bloom Size: 3/4 – 1 inch

IN THE GARDEN

Container: Yes
Weather Tolerance: Frost
Garden Spacing: 12 inches
Hanging Basket: Yes
Low Edging: Yes
